What is a mixed-use offering memorandum?

Mixed-use offering memorandums (often abbreviated as "OM") serve as the primary marketing document in most CRE transactions, and are typically prepared by a broker or seller to present a property or investment thesis to prospective buyers. Ranging anywhere from 10 to hundreds of pages, these OMs typically include a property overview, rent roll or lease summary, financial pro forma, market comparables, location demographics and terms of the offering. In contrast to residential OMs, these memos tend to put cap rates, NOI, occupancy, and lease structure front and center.

What does a great offering memorandum look like?

The strongest OMs lead with a clear investment thesis, make it easy to find key financials and cap rate, and include a deep-dive into market comps and the location.
